Try this to make sure the motor works and the hydraulics work. First make sure that the battery negative terminal wire is firmly attached to the pump. Then take a jumper cable and attach it to the positive terminal on the battery, then take the other end of that cable an firmly hold it on the motor terminal, the motor should run and the top should go up. This eliminates all the wiring and the solenoid. Post back if the top goes up, then I will tell you how to check the solenoid.
Voila! This did the trick Went right up bypassing the solenoid and wiring. Ready for my next lesson - how to check the solenoid lol
